EPM to Focus on Film: Crowley Takes Over Hardware Sales

Eastman Park Micrographics (EPM) has refined its business with the recent launch of a wholly owned subsidiary, Eastman Park Micrographics Equipment (EPME). EPME will focus on the distribution of EPM’s Imagelink hardware and software. In addition, EPME has signed on the Crowley Company to handle all its sales and marketing. EPM, meanwhile, has narrowed its focus to distribution of microfilm media.

Scanning Innovators Team up to Continue Breakthrough Strategies

In the mid-1980s, Jeff Helm of Mekel brought the world its first microfilm and microfiche scanners, and in 1993 Kevin Keeler was the first to bring Wicks and Wilson scanning products from DOS to Windows 3. Now the two former competitors have joined forces on one team to work on scanning breakthroughs together.
